What Does Landscaping Service Mean in South Ottawa?
Landscaping service in our area is more than just mowing. It’s a full range of care to keep your property safe, beautiful, and functional through all our seasons.
- Lawn Care & Mowing: Regular trimming to keep your grass healthy.
- Landscape Design & Planting: Choosing plants that thrive in our local soil and climate.
- Irrigation Installation & Repair: Fixing broken sprinklers and setting up efficient watering systems.
- Hardscaping: Building patios, walkways, and retaining walls to add structure to your yard.
- Tree Trimming & Emergency Removal: Safely caring for or removing trees, especially after storms.
- Drainage and Grading: Solving problems with standing water or erosion.
- Seasonal Cleanups: Clearing leaves in fall and preparing beds in spring.
Routine maintenance keeps things looking good, while emergency landscaping handles sudden, dangerous problems.
What Counts as an Emergency Landscaping Issue?
Some yard problems can’t wait. Here’s when to call for immediate help:
- A tree or large limb has fallen and is leaning against your house, garage, or car.
- Heavy rain has caused severe soil erosion, and you see your foundation or driveway starting to wash out.
- Your yard is flooded with deep standing water, and it’s getting close to your home’s foundation or a septic system.
- A storm has exposed utility lines in your yard. If you see downed power lines, stay back and call Ameren Illinois immediately at 1-800-755-5000.
- A large broken limb is resting on power lines. Don’t go near it—call the utility and then a pro.
Safety always comes first.
South Ottawa's Climate, Soil, and Your Landscape
Our local weather and dirt play a big role in your landscaping needs. South Ottawa experiences hot, humid summers and cold winters with freeze-thaw cycles. Spring can bring heavy rain and thunderstorms rolling off the Illinois River.
Many yards here have clay-heavy soil, which drains slowly and can crack when dry. This affects everything from planting to drainage. Homes in older areas like Northside often have mature trees with big root systems. Newer developments might have smaller yards that need smart design.
Choosing the right plants is key. You need hardy perennials and grasses that can handle our humidity and winter chill. A good local landscaper knows what works.

Understanding Local Landscaping Costs
We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Costs depend on the job's size, materials, and urgency.
- Emergency Call-Out: For after-hours or immediate response, there is typically a premium due to overtime and rapid mobilization.
- Labor: Priced hourly for general work or as a flat rate for projects.
- Materials: Sod, mulch, stone, and plants add to the cost.
- Equipment: Specialized tools like chippers or cranes have associated fees.
- Disposal: Hauling away green waste or old materials.
- Permits: Some tree removals or significant grading work may require a city permit.
Based on local averages, here are some example scenarios with estimated cost ranges:
- Emergency Fallen Small Tree Removal: Crew with chipper. Estimate: $200 – $800.
- Large Tree Removal (Crane/Permit): For big, complex jobs. Estimate: $1,200 – $5,000+.
- Drainage Correction (French Drain): To solve standing water. Estimate: $1,000 – $4,000.
- New Sod Installation: For an average-sized yard. Estimate: $1,000 – $3,000.
- Irrigation Repair: Diagnostic fee: $75 – $150. Repairs: $100 – $800+.
These are estimates. Always get a written, itemized quote for your specific project.

Safety Checklist: What to Do Until Help Arrives
If you have a landscaping emergency, follow these steps:
- Keep all people and pets away from the hazard zone.
- If you see downed power lines, stay back at least 30 feet and call Ameren Illinois at 1-800-755-5000 immediately. Do not touch anything.
-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.
-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flooding areas.
- If an irrigation line is broken and flooding the yard, find and shut off the main water valve to the system.
- Secure any loose patio furniture or objects that could blow away.
Important: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. It’s dangerous. Always call 811 before you dig for any project to locate underground utilities.
Local Permits and Rules in South Ottawa
Some landscaping work needs approval. For tree removal, the City of Ottawa (which South Ottawa is part of) may require a permit, especially for larger trees or those in certain zones. Always check with the Ottawa City Building Department before starting a major project. If your home is part of an HOA, check their rules for any visible changes. For work near the Illinois River shoreline, additional permits may be needed.
Choosing a Landscaping Contractor in South Ottawa
Pick a partner you can trust. Look for a licensed and insured company with proven local experience. Ask for references and photos of past work. Read online reviews from other South Ottawa homeowners. A reliable contractor will give you a transparent, written estimate, explain their disposal plan, and handle any necessary permits. For tree work, an ISA-Certified Arborist is a plus.
